MANGALORE: Muslim Forum staged a massive protest infront of a Deputy Commissioner's office at around 3:30 pm. to pay homage to the murdered human rights advocate Naushad Kashimji and to protest against his brutal killing. In a five-point resolution, the organisers condemned the death of Kashimji and conferred martyrdom on him. They vowed to intensify the stir if the Police Department failed to arrest the culprits by April 30. Muslim Forum demanded that the case be handed over to the Central Bureau of Investigation and the police officers accused by senior advocate K. Purshotham Poojary of murdering Kashimji be removed from the team which is investigating the case.

The programme began with the recitation of Quran by Ishaque Puttur. Mr K L Ashok, (General Secretary of Karnataka Komu Soharda Vedike), inaugurated the programme and Anwar Saadat, co-convener of the Federation presented the introductory remarks. He said, no justice could be expected from the police, as they are puppets in the hands of Sangh Parivar outfits, which are at the helm of affairs in the government. Referring to the police denial of receiving a complaint filed by Naushad's senior Advocate Purushotham Poojary against certain police officials, he said this claim of theirs is on the one hand and appointing the very same officials to investigate the case gives rise to serious suspicion. He also alleged that some sections of the media and the police force were conspiring to tarnish the image of Kashimji and justify his killing. Citing various police encounters Mr. Saadath said people were losing faith in the police.
 

Inaugurating the meeting K L Ashok said, the role of police officials, underworld criminals and political leaders has been prima facie proved in this case. Naushad always fought for justice and protection of human rights. He said: “The freedom we achieved in 1947 has fallen prey to the bullet of a criminalised police force that targets human rights activists.” Apprehending that the life of such activists in the State are in danger under the BJP government, Mr. Ashok said: “We will not allow Karnataka to become another Gujarat.

Naushad preferred to fight crucial cases related to death of Padmapriya, Udupi MLA K Raghupathi Bhat's wife, death of Mulky Rafique in a police encounter and this earned him enemies. He also said, It is strange that police officials, involvement of whom is suspected in Naushad's murder have been appointed as the investigating officers.
 

Popular Front of India national general secretary K M Sharif said Naushad's murder is a threat and challenge to the judicial system of India. Progressive and secular individuals and organisations have to fight against this tendency, otherwise, there may be several such murders in future, he warned. He also said: “As a lawyer, he saved several lives and prevented fake encounters by the police through legal means,”
 

On this occasion, several prominent speakers including Rafiuddin Kudroli (President New Age India Forum, Mangalore), Prof Umesh Chandra (Lecturer Mangalore University), Muhammed Kunhi (Manager Shanti Prakashan, Mangalore), S B Muhammed Darimi (President, Darimis Association, South Kanara), Y Muhammed Kunji (President District Waqf committee), Shaafi Saadi Nandavar (Secretary Saadi Education Trust, Bangalore), B Muhammed Haji Muhiddin (President Seerat Committee, Mangalore) were also addressed the crowd who were gathered from different parts of the district.
 

More than ten thousand strong crowd participated in the demonstration and a memorandum was submitted to the District Magistrate demanding fair investigation by handing over the case to CBI.

Zameer Ambar, (Convenor South Kanara Muslim Forum), presided over the function and Ali Hassan presented vote of thanks. The function was concluded in the evening.

Sare Jahan Se Accha

Hindustan Hamara

In 1905 more than 100 years from today, when Iqbal was a lecturer at the Government College, Lahore he was invited by his student Lala Hardayal to preside over a function. Instead of making a speech, Iqbal sang Sare Jahan Se Accha Hindustan Hamara in his style. Iqbal compiled this poem in praise of India and the poem preaches the communal harmony that had unfortunately started ceasing in India by that time.
